An incredibly frustrating outing.
I've seen enough of Ole Miss to know that they can defend it really well. Mizzou gave a pretty good outing on the defensive end, allowing less than 1 ppp.
But Mizzou simply was not good enough for significant stretches.
Consider
From the time mizzou shot two technical free throws in the first half at 9:27 to the 16:56 mark of the second half:
18 possessions
7 points
2-15
4 turnovers
The last 5:26 of regulation when game was tied
9 possessions
5 points
2-9 fg
2 turnovers
That's damn near a half's worth of game play and the Tigers tallied 12 points on 4-24 shooting with 6 turnovers.
In nut cutting time, they failed miserably.
Ole miss did a good job of limiting transition opportunities, slowing the pace using the clock, switching defenses and making winning plays. They were a desperate team. They get some credit. They're not a great matchup stylistically. All true.
But damn, this game was sitting on a silver platter and the home squad just turned their nose up at it time and time again. Incredibly frustrating to see our group not be able to take control of the game. Missed bunnies, bad reads, lackadaisical offense. Was a great example of how NOT to play confident, attacking offense. Even when they needed to just get a shot off, pounding the ball on the ground and nothing.
The officials allowed this to turn into a brawl, but 4 second half free throws is proof positive they weren't aggressive enough. They played hard, they just didn't play aggressive. There's a difference.
Props to the front line for playing hard and relatively effectively. Mark, Tilmon and Kobe combined for 33 on 13-24, 20 boards, 5 assists, 3 steals and 4 blocks.
The other 113 minutes played by 7 guys? You can do the math when we finish with 53 on 20/57 shooting.
